The problem is SereneLife is an Importer from US, it is ok if you are in US. They import and sell many things that is not related to sauna. Sometimes they pop after a year and need a board or fuse replacement. Firzone is in the UK and specialises in this. You can get many spare parts when the warranty finishes. You can even get a new cover when it is worn out so you will have a new looking sauna all over again.

I have had to cut down on ice baths because my feet would ache when I would go to sleep at night … so not everything is for everyone! Well done you. PS we don’t need to use super cold water! There is research on being in cool/tepid baths for longer and they provide similar results. Another idea is wearing scuba gloves on hands and feet so they don’t get as cold. PPS You’re super amazing!
